Beyond basic mortgages, homeowners with considerable equity can explore a HELOC or a Home Equity Loan.} A Home Equity Loan provides a single lump sum of funds, which is repaid over a set period with a stable rate. Conversely, a Home Equity Line of Credit works more like a revolving account. You only accrue interest on the portion you actually spend, which offers unmatched flexibility. The reverse mortgage is a unique product intended for seniors. Different from regular mortgages, a reverse mortgage allows homeowners to transform a portion of their property value into tax-free proceeds without having to move out of the home or pay monthly installments.
